Output 3ad827376f4855125ee8d57fa3d85a5fdc4c4dc87e7a89cf7a8da23a428d85e5:11

value
299560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3996c3132e7bc13b1f0d8bf1b7df1eacfcfb96 OP_EQUAL
address
3K87yXmRjKAUCGMGdL6Vsd9EGfocjw54hB
transaction
3ad827376f4855125ee8d57fa3d85a5fdc4c4dc87e7a89cf7a8da23a428d85e5
confirmations
376530
spent
true